At around 1.30pm on Thursday 13 December a digger was stolen from outside a house on Flag Lane North in Upton.
Enquiries into the incident are ongoing and detectives believe that the man in the CCTV image may be able to help with their investigation.
They are urging anyone who recognises him or thinks they may know who he is to get in touch.
Detective Constable Keith Campbell said: “We believe the man in the CCTV image may have important information to help with our ongoing investigation into the theft of a digger/mini excavator in Upton, Chester.
